How much do community development j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for community development in Lincoln, NE is $68,805.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,800.00 and $82,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a community development?

A Community Development job focuses on improving the well-being of communities by promoting economic, social, and environmental initiatives. Professionals in this field work with local organizations, government agencies, and residents to address issues such as affordable housing, education, public health, and economic opportunities. Their role often involves planning programs, securing funding, and fostering partnerships to drive sustainable growth and positive change.

What are the primary challenges faced in a community development role?

Professionals in Community Development often encounter challenges such as balancing the needs and interests of diverse community stakeholders, addressing limited resources or funding, and overcoming resistance to change within communities. Navigating complex regulations and coordinating with various government agencies or nonprofit partners can also add layers of complexity. However, these challenges are opportunities to develop creative solutions, advocate for underrepresented populations, and make meaningful improvements in quality of life. The role typically requires strong problem-solving skills and the ability to remain adaptable and resilient in dynamic environments.

About Ho-Chunk, Inc. & WarHorse Gaming

Ho-Chunk, Inc. is the award-winning economic development corporation of the Winnebago Tribe of Nebraska. Its mission is to drive long-term economic growth and create meaningful employment opportunities for Tribal members. Through a diverse portfolio of businesses, Ho-Chunk, Inc. supports community development while preserving culture and strengthening sovereignty.

WarHorse Gaming is a gaming and entertainment division of Ho-Chunk, Inc., developed in partnership with the Nebraska Horsemen's Benevolent and Protective Association (HBPA). The company is responsible for managing the expansion of casino gaming at Nebraska's historic horse racing venues, with properties in Lincoln, Omaha, and South Sioux City. WarHorse Gaming blends state-of-the-art casino operations with local economic development and community impact. Rooted in Tribal values and driven by guest experience, WarHorse aims to create premier destinations that elevate entertainment in the region.

Position SummaryThe Surveillance Operator I is responsible for monitoring, documenting, and reporting activity across the property to safeguard company assets, ensure compliance with state regulations, and uphold company policies and procedures. This role uses surveillance technology and direct observation to support investigations, regulatory compliance, and operational integrity.

Key Responsibilities

  • Monitor guest and employee activity using closed-circuit television (CCTV) systems and personal observation to identify potential criminal activity, regulatory violations, or internal control concerns.

  • Capture, track, and document video evidence for compliance, investigations, and risk management purposes.

  • Record and report questionable activities, preparing written reports for appropriate personnel.

  • Monitor and respond to alarm systems.

  • Review video footage to resolve disputes, identify suspicious or illegal activity, and support other departments as needed.

  • Maintain strict confidentiality of property and company-related information.

  • Operate monitoring room equipment, including computers and camera systems.

  • Support investigations and participate in court actions related to gaming violations when required.

  • Prepare accurate daily reports and logs of surveillance activities.

  • Conduct audits of operational procedures (e.g., count rooms, slots, food and beverage, cage, and security) and document findings.

  • Ensure all surveillance equipment functions properly during assigned shifts.

  • Conduct routine video surveillance and maintain detailed records of observed activities in gaming and non-gaming areas.

  • Respond to requests from supervisors, management, regulatory bodies, and other departments.

  • Perform other duties as assigned.
